Transaction 5a75ddc8b8969e86d62c889e4c584cf5c3dfb9e41d94cb4ff6966b2469f73434

1 Input
1 Outputs
  • 5a75ddc8b8969e86d62c889e4c584cf5c3dfb9e41d94cb4ff6966b2469f73434:0
  • value  654209
    address  37Vpkz3LXGXKPXwY12sPvutFFz4Sdta3nM